Recently I added a new AF_PACKET fanout operation mode in commit
2d36097, but I forgot to document it.  Add PACKET_FANOUT_QM as an available mode
in the af_packet documentation.  Applies to net-next.

@@ -583,6 +583,7 @@ Currently implemented fanout policies are:
   - PACKET_FANOUT_CPU: schedule to socket by CPU packet arrives on
   - PACKET_FANOUT_RND: schedule to socket by random selection
   - PACKET_FANOUT_ROLLOVER: if one socket is full, rollover to another
+  - PACKET_FANOUT_QM: schedule to socket by skbs recorded queue_mapping
